Cloudflare is seeking a Business Development Manager to lead and mentor a team of Business Development Representatives (BDRs) in a hybrid role based in New York or Austin. This is a people-management position focused on driving high-quality outbound pipeline while developing the next generation of sales and cross-functional talent.
Key responsibilities include leading team execution to hit and exceed outbound pipeline targets through rigorous prospecting and lead qualification; maintaining alignment with Sales, Marketing, and Operations leaders on strategy and pipeline optimization; driving adoption of AI tools and building automated workflows to maximize rep efficiency; analyzing performance metrics to identify inefficiencies and skill gaps; actively coaching BDRs on core sales skills and preparing them for promotion into Account Executive, Customer Success, Sales Engineering, Marketing, and Operations roles; partnering with Talent Acquisition to recruit and onboard diverse BDR talent; and championing a company-first mentality aligned with broader business objectives.
The role requires 1–3+ years of direct experience managing BDR/SDR teams or proven high-performing sales rep experience with a strong track record of formally mentoring peers. Candidates should have a history of consistently exceeding outbound quota targets and driving measurable pipeline growth in fast-paced B2B environments. Experience with funnel management across multiple channels (inbound, upsell, outbound, partners, marketing) and proficiency with BDR tool stacks including Salesforce are expected.
